Impact DescriptionCrassula helmsii is one of ten weed species in England that have a negative impact on angling and is estimated to cost angling 170,636 pounds across the 10km affected stretch of river. Removal of Crassula helmsii ranges from 1,450-7,225 pounds per pond.
